Latest Patents
Goby's latest patents revolve around advanced methods, apparatuses, and systems designed for the continuous inactivation of viruses during the manufacture of biological products. The patented methods detail a systematic approach that includes the combination of a biological product with a virus-inactivation reagent. The process ensures that the resulting treatment composition meets specific properties necessary for effective virus inactivation. The continuous processing involves several steps: verifying the treatment composition, transferring it to a dedicated treatment vessel equipped with a static mixer, and maintaining optimal conditions for incubation and flow.
